Geoff Bailey

2023
Tourism, Culture, Arts and Recreation

Geoff Bailey is a Parks Director with the Department of Tourism, Culture, Arts and Recreation. Through a progressive outlook and with perseverance, he saw an opportunity to greatly reduce the carbon footprint of provincial parks and led an initiative to make positive change.

Over the course of four years, Mr. Bailey oversaw the development and installation of solar power systems and battery banks at three provincial parks that could not connect to the provincial electrical grid, and as a result were operating on diesel generators.

A new and innovative approach for Provincial Government infrastructure, the project was the first of its kind in the ParksNL system. Mr. Bailey was instrumental in all phases of the project, from the original proposal to securing funding, researching options and working with staff and contractors to address supply challenges and technical issues.

The completion of this project meant the noisy sounds of a diesel generator were replaced by the tranquil and peaceful sounds of nature, which can now be enjoyed by the staff and visitors of the parks. It also resulted in significant savings in fuel and substantial environmental benefits through the reduction of greenhouse gas emissions.
